Museum ambiance and captured light: Interior of the Frans Hals Museum
The art print of the interior of the Frans Hals Museum captures a cozy atmosphere where electric light interacts with the shadows of visitors and paintings. Dolf Van Roy composes with a soft palette and precise touches that reproduce the texture of frames and the depth of the room, offering an almost photographic perspective but imbued with a painterly sensitivity. The eye wanders among silhouettes, reflections, and architectural details, creating a lively and contemplative scene. This interpretation highlights perspective and contrast, inviting prolonged immersion in the space.
Dolf Van Roy, a contemporary heir to a museum tradition
Dolf Van Roy's art demonstrates a familiarity with museum painting and the European figurative tradition: his work reinterprets the staging of artworks and visitors with an awareness of art history. Influenced by Dutch Golden Age compositions and modern realism, Van Roy favors meticulous observation and clarity of form. His works dialogue with the great masters without pastiche, offering a contemporary reading of exhibition interiors.
